Local Direct Mail Advertising VS Local Online Advertising; What Is Better?

You can find advantages with local direct mail small business advertising. I'm talking about advertising and marketing with local direct mail organizations that send out directories, envelopes packed of discount coupons, and mass mailed postcards.

Unsolicited mail is nearly always checked out even if it is then tossed away. Mass mailed postcards are almost always study before they are tossed away or kept.

Radio marketing might be rewarding, however the listener needs to be listening to the precise station at the precise time your ad plays, or your attempt was futile. Similar with TV. Newspaper advertising and marketing could work, however the reader must locate your advertisement in the newspaper, if the prospects open the newspaper at all. But in reality nobody travels out to their mailbox, pulls out their pile of mail, and tosses it away without looking at each piece of mail.

Possibly 35% of main firms use Twitter, Maybe 60% use Facebook. But in reality 100% use direct mail. Why is that? Because your profits from the advertising will then be tracked. Direct mail pieces will be kept, looked at for a second time, shown to friends, and brought into your store to have as a shopping list.


But in reality which is the single most cost-effective use for direct mail, notably postcards?

Pretty much every marketing approach utilized in small business; radio, signage, direct mail, tv, and more really needs a link to your small business internet site. Furthermore there should be a motivation for the customer to need to visit your internet site. It can be a contest, coupon, special offer, free report, free helpful articles....anything that produces a yearning to stop with your internet site.

Simply stating "Find out more at our website" isn't a good motivation to go to see your internet site. "Visit our website to get a $20 Gift Certificate that can be used for any new purchase" is a good reason to visit your website.

Direct mail, Yellow Pages, TV, postcards, and radio each still create profit when they're utilized wisely, and your results tested. Considered one of the surest ways to insure that your advertising and marketing pays off is to make every offline advertisement a link to your website, where you should reveal a far more complete sales presentation as to why the customer would want to visit your small retail business or call your small business and purchase from your business.

Why do you need to have an online presence? In the year 2011 fully 67% of all of the Yellow Page searches are done online as opposed to in your Yellow Page print directory. And where are people doing their searches? At Google & Youtube. Not on Facebook. Not on Twitter.

When people are looking for options online in order to progress to a buying decision, the customers go to Google. Their next place they go is Youtube. Everyplace else totaled together will be a distant third place.

Now, how do you ensure that you have got the biggest and most profitable listings on Google and Youtube? Not by having one listing, and hoping you will be found on the first page of their Google search. It's not by purchasing pricey Pay Per Click advertisements. With local online advertising PPC advertisements are not even helpful..

Articles, videos, news items, publicity releases, and reviews about your local business are what stand out to a shoppers. It is possible to either create this work by yourself at no cost, or simply recruit someone to take action on your behalf.

But in reality, I am not simply meaning one article, one video, or even one website. You'll need to completely dominate the local online search results. To accomplish this, you really need your real information (articles, videos, etc) on lots of websites, each with the power to get found highly in the Search Engines (Google is the largest search engine). Purchasing "Featured Listings" in online directories is just one such misuse of money.

Actually, you will discover plenty of Online Advertising Myths found on the web which have been spread by people that have not actually created a penny by promoting their core business online. The stuff you need to pass up is advertising and marketing online with one of these scam artists, then after you get no profits from the advertising, persuading yourself that local online advertising and marketing doesn't produce a profit in anyway.
